Summary

Liverpool enters the new season with a roster facing significant personnel questions after the transfer window closed. The current squad contains depth at left wing but lacks established right-sided options and faces uncertainty at right-back and in the central defense. Sporting director Richard Hughes is reportedly departing the club at the end of his contract to join Al-Hilal, leaving a vacancy at a time when the team requires major structural adjustments. Several key players have contracts expiring next year, while others face ongoing injury recovery concerns. Head coach Andoni Iraola must now manage a squad that analysts describe as fundamentally imbalanced. The club faces critical decisions regarding its future personnel and strategic direction heading into the next transfer window.
